Choosing the Right Safari Destination
Africa is home to numerous safari destinations, each offering distinct experiences. Some popular options include:
- Kenya and Tanzania: Known for the Great Migration and iconic parks like the Serengeti and Maasai Mara.
- South Africa: Famous for Kruger National Park and luxury lodges in Sabi Sands.
- Botswana: Renowned for the Okavango Delta's waterways and diverse wildlife.
- Namibia: Offers unique desert landscapes and rare species.
Consider the time of year, type of wildlife you wish to see, and the level of luxury you desire when choosing your destination.
When to Go on Safari
The best time for a safari varies by region. Generally, the dry season (June to October) is ideal for wildlife viewing, as animals congregate around water sources. However, visiting during the green season (November to May) can offer lush landscapes and fewer crowds. Research your chosen destination's specific climate and seasonal highlights to plan accordingly.

Types of Luxury Safari Accommodations
Luxury safaris offer a range of accommodation options, from lavish lodges to exclusive tented camps. Many lodges feature private plunge pools, gourmet dining, and personalized service. Tented camps provide an authentic yet luxurious experience, often with en-suite bathrooms and plush furnishings. Consider your comfort preferences and desired level of immersion when selecting accommodations.
The Safari Experience
A typical day on a luxury safari includes morning and afternoon game drives led by expert guides. These drives offer opportunities to witness Africa's iconic wildlife, from elephants and lions to giraffes and zebras. Many lodges also offer walking safaris for a more intimate exploration of the landscape. Between activities, guests can indulge in spa treatments or relax by the pool.

Planning Your Luxury Safari
When planning your safari, consider working with a reputable tour operator specializing in luxury experiences. They can tailor your itinerary to your interests and ensure seamless logistics. Be sure to check visa requirements for your destination and discuss any health precautions with your doctor, such as vaccinations or malaria prophylaxis.
Packing Essentials for Your Safari
Packing for a safari requires thoughtful consideration of both functionality and comfort. Essential items include:
- Neutral-colored clothing: Opt for breathable fabrics in earth tones to blend with the environment.
- Sunscreen and insect repellent: Protect yourself from the sun and insects during outdoor activities.
- Binoculars: Enhance your wildlife viewing experience with a good pair of binoculars.
- Camera equipment: Capture unforgettable moments with quality photography gear.
